We still need independent verification from a stock locked device user employing the minimally edited XML with RSD Lite to successfully revert, reroot and flash forwards again.

Then we have a complete and safely and predictably usable solution.

 

This, completely.  The process should be this:

 

o) Flash the MR2 FXZ with my modified RSD Downgrade script (WILL keep data)

o) Use Motochopper to root

o) Ensure su binary is up to date (this is important)

o) Use Voodoo OTA Root Keeper to protect root

o) Take the OTA upgrade

o) Restore root with Voodoo

 

This should be done on a locked phone.  Please post results.

After rooting could I run moto apocalypse to unlock b4 accepting ota?

Sent from my DROID RAZR HD using Tapatalk 2

 

No.  If you've taken the update, it's flashed the TZ partition.  The TZ is the Trusted Zone and once that's flashed, the exploit is patched.  That partition can't be reverted even on unlocked phones so there's no hope of an unlock.  But I mean root's nothing to sneeze at so hopefully this works.
